The Rules Of Community Living

Homeowners’ associations (HOAs) exist to establish and enforce rules intended to provide a level of conformity for people living within an established community, whether it be a condominium, a co-op or a common interest development (CID) of stand-alone houses. But even in these communities with their covenants, conditions and restrictions (CC&Rs), sometimes conflicts can arise when the expectations of a homeowner and the association clash.

Often, HOA-related conflicts have to do with association dues, maintenance issues or situations where aesthetic mandates clash with individual freedom. Many of these disputes can be prevented by knowing your HOA’s rules before committing to a Georgia property. HOAs can put limits on everything from paint colors, landscaping and noise to holiday decorations and home businesses, where such restrictions do not represent harassment, discrimination, misappropriation of funds or contract violation. Make sure you’re aware of the rules of your HOA before pursuing legal action in a dispute.
